How to Allow Shell Access With Plesk
Shell access is a way of remotely controlling a system using command-line input. You may wish to give shell access to an advanced user's account to allow them to make use of basic UNIX system tools, command-line editing, SFTP and crontab support.
Instructions

1
Log into your Plesk account using your administrative username and password.

2
Click "E. Manager" on the top of the screen, then select "Shell Request Manager."

3
Click "Allow" to the right of the username you'd like to grant shell access to. The specified user can now log into the system using a secure shell client.
